Carlyle Harmon, former chairman of the board for the Eyring Research Institute, will speak Oct. 13 at Brigham Young University.

Harmon, 83, will discuss his 60-year career as a chemical engineer and will provide examples of scientific development in the engineering field as part of the School of Management's Executive Lecture Series at 2 p.m. and 4 p.m. in 710 Tanner Building.Harmon directed the efforts of the Eyring Research Institute from 1973 to 1986 and has been issued 37 patents in the United States with corresponding patents abroad.
